How We Work
1
Emergency Call
Your urgent call connects you to our rapid response team. We gather initial damage details and dispatch a crew immediately, often arriving within an hour. This swift action prevents further water intrusion, preparing for the on-site assessment.
2
On-Site Assessment
Our technicians use moisture meters and thermal imaging to precisely map water damage. We identify affected areas, categorize water contamination, and develop a comprehensive restoration plan. This detailed analysis informs our extraction strategy.
3
Water Extraction
High-powered pumps and industrial-strength wet vacuums remove standing water quickly. We extract water from carpets, subfloors, and structural elements. Efficient extraction is crucial for effective drying.
4
Drying & Dehumidification
Air movers and commercial dehumidifiers create optimal drying conditions. We monitor humidity levels and moisture content daily. This prevents mold growth and prepares the area for cleaning.
5
Cleaning & Sanitizing
We clean and sanitize all affected surfaces using professional-grade antimicrobial treatments. This eliminates odors and prevents future microbial growth. Your property will be safe and fresh for repairs.
6
Restoration & Repair
Our skilled team rebuilds and repairs damaged structures. This includes drywall, flooring, and other compromised materials. We restore your property to its pre-damage condition, completing the process.

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Cost in Mission, KS

The cost of truck-mounted water extraction in Mission, KS can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. We offer competitive pricing and a free on-site assessment to find out the exact cost of the job. Get a free quote. Act fast. Get your property back to normal.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Truck-Mounted Water Extraction $500 - $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Drying and Dehumidification $200 - $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$100 - $500 Type of equipment used, size of affected area
Final Inspection and Certification $50 - $200 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
